Subway Service Alerts: Brooklyn Heights and Nearby

This will be another “green light weekend” for service at local stations, as there are no planned re-routings or cancellations directly affecting service at those stations. However, late nights and early mornings the following week — Monday, December 19 to Friday, December 23 — there will be two changes affecting local service. There will be no 3 train service in either direction. For those traveling to or from Brooklyn, 4 trains will be making all 3 stops between Atlantic Avenue-Barclays Center and New Lots Avenue and 2 trains will be making all other 3 stops. Also, during theses same late night-early morning hours, there will be no Brooklyn bound service at High Street, as Brooklyn bound A trains will be running on the F line between West 4th Street-Washington Square in Manhattan and Jay Street-MetroTech.

These are the PLANNED service changes directly affecting local stations. Always check MTA Info for unplanned service changes that may affect local service or service on other parts of your trip, or for planned service changes that affect stations to or from which you may be traveling.
